High-Performance Protective Fabrics for Extreme Operational Zones
Ironteks Protech product line is exclusively engineered to shield workers against life-threatening industrial risks including flash fire, convective heat, electric arc discharges, molten iron splashes, and tactical ballistic impacts. Formulated from blends of meta/para-aramids (Nomex & Kevlar), Lenzing FR fibers, and specialized anti-static carbon grids, our materials combine heavy-duty protection with physical flexibility and breathability.
Protech technical weaves act as the principal protective envelope for firefighter taskforces, high-voltage utility workers, petrochemical extraction teams, smelting foundries, and police/military tactical personnel.
Key Characteristics & Defense Levels
- Inherently Flame Retardant (Inherently FR): High temperature resilience built directly into the fiber's chemical structure. It never wears off or degrades during laundering cycles.
- Electric Arc Defense (EN 61482): Extreme thermal defense values (ATPV / EBT) against intense heat waves released during electric short-circuit flashes.
- Electrostatic Dissipation (EN 1149): Conductive carbon grids safely release static voltages, avoiding sparking in explosive environments.
Technical Specifications Table
| Fabric Code | Composition Details | Weight (g/m²) | Thermal Limit | Certifications |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Protech FR-220 | 93% Meta-Aramid, 5% Para-Aramid, 2% Anti-static | 220 ± 5% | 380°C (Continuous) | EN 469, EN 11612, EN 1149 |
| Protech ARC-350 | 50% Aramid, 48% Lenzing FR, 2% Carbon Grid | 350 ± 5% | 400°C (Continuous) | EN 61482 Class 2, EN 11612 |
| Protech BAL-480 | 100% High-Tenacity Para-Aramid (Kevlar) | 480 ± 5% | 450°C (Continuous) | NIJ 0101.06 (Ballistics Level IIIA) |
